Return on Industrial Insurance (R.O.I.I.) Programs
Members of the Master Builders Association of Pierce County may qualify to participate in the BIAW Return of Industrial Insurance (R.O.I.I) or "Retro" program. Retro is the general name used for programs the State of Washington allows employers to participate in whereby they can receive substantial refunds on their L&I premiums. Currently approximately 60% of premiums paid to the State of Washington Department of Labor and Industries are subject to Retro refunds. In addition to the potential refuns you could realize, the retro program also offers assitance with workers comp claims and safety program set up and review.
The BIAW Retro program has become the largest retrospective ratings group in the State of Washington with members receiving an average of a 25% refund of L&I Workers Compensation premiums. This is a great program established over 25 years ago with a statewide buy in power of over 6000 member companies.
